The Anderson County Chamber of Commerce has elected new board officers for 2015. Here is submitted information on those elected.

Stephen Harris has been named chairman of the board, Rob Followell has been elected chair-elect, and Amy Allen has been elected treasurer for Anderson County Chamber of Commerce. Steve Heatherly has been named member-at-large.

Stephen Harris, engineering manager at Powell-Clinch Utility District, where he has worked for 14 years, is responsible for the daily operation of the Engineering, IT, and Building Maintenance Departments. Stephen is a graduate of Leadership Anderson County and has served as co-chair of the Chamber’s Government and Community Relations Council. [Read more…]

Anderson County Mayor Terry Frank will host a community meeting to organize efforts to bring broadband Internet access to unserved areas in Anderson County.

The community meeting will be held on Tuesday, September 23, from 6:30 to 8 p.m. in the Community Room at the Norris Community Building, located at 20 Chestnut Drive.

“As mayor, I want to continue to work on efforts to see people in our communities have access to the Internet,” Frank said in a press release. “Expanding access will expand educational opportunities and resources, will help attract more families to choose Anderson County as a place to live, and will increase our economic opportunities.
